Welcome to the forum Amanda, try from the main PP menu, going to "Tools" > "PPtweaker..." > "Misc 2" to make sure the option "IMAP: Delete messages to trash" is checked (of course you must be using "IMAP" for your email protocol).

If the trash folder isn't overridden (as in your case), then PP uses a couple of techniques to figure out the appropriate trash folder:
1) Some servers will flag which folder is the trash (not all servers support this and/or not all mailboxes have set the designation)
2) POP Peeper looks for existing commonly used trash folder names
3) If all else fails, POP Peeper will create and use "inbox.trash"

If you have a "deleted items" folder, then that's the folder that POP Peeper should attempt to use based on rule #2 above.


I just created a test for this -- I created a new mailbox on my mail server and it starts with no folders except "Inbox" (ie. no inbox.trash, and therefore the server cannot designate that as the special trash folder). Using the webmail interface, I created a "Deleted Items" folder (and did not designate it as the trash folder). I then sent the mailbox a message, and then deleted it -- POP Peeper found and moved the deleted message to the "Deleted Items" folder. This was tested with a non-Pro license. Summary: it's working as expected.
